What is Topography?

Topography refers to the shape and physical features of the Earth’s surface, including its elevation and contours. It provides valuable information for various industries such as architecture, urban planning, and landscape design. By importing topography into SketchUp, you can accurately represent real-world landscapes in your 3D models.

Step 1: Obtaining Topographic Data

To import topography into SketchUp, you first need to acquire the necessary data. There are several sources where you can find topographic data:

  • National Mapping Agencies: Many countries have their own mapping agencies that provide publicly available topographic data. Examples include the United States Geological Survey (USGS) and the Ordnance Survey (OS) in the United Kingdom.
  • Online GIS Platforms: Websites like OpenStreetMap and ArcGIS offer access to geospatial data, including topographic information.
  • Digital Elevation Models (DEMs): DEMs are raster files that contain elevation information for specific geographic areas. You can find DEMs from various sources such as NASA’s Shuttle Radar Topography Mission (SRTM) or commercial providers like GeoData.

Once you have obtained your desired topographic data, proceed to the next step.

Step 2: Preparing Topographic Data

In order to import topography into SketchUp, you may need to prepare the data for compatibility. SketchUp supports various file formats, including:

  • GeoTIFF: A georeferenced raster format commonly used for topographic data.
  • DEM: Digital Elevation Models, as mentioned earlier.
  • Shapefiles: A popular vector format that includes both geometric and attribute information. You can convert your topographic data into shapefiles using GIS software like QGIS.

If your topographic data is in a different format, consider using GIS software to convert it into a compatible format before proceeding to the next step.

Step 3: Importing Topography into SketchUp

To import the prepared topographic data into SketchUp, follow these steps:

  1. Open SketchUp: Launch SketchUp on your computer if you haven’t already done so.
  2. Create a New Project: Start a new project or open an existing one where you want to import the topography.
  3. Select “File” Menu: Click on the “File” menu at the top-left corner of the interface.
  4. Navigate to Import Options: From the dropdown menu, select “Import” and then choose “Import” again from the submenu that appears.
  5. Select Topographic Data File: In the file selection dialog box, browse and locate your prepared topographic data file. Select it and click “Open”.
  6. Adjust Import Settings: Depending on your file type, SketchUp may provide options such as specifying the coordinate system or adjusting the import scale.

    Make any necessary adjustments and click “Import”.

  7. Wait for Import: SketchUp will process the imported data, and depending on the file size and complexity, it may take some time.
  8. Edit and Enhance: Once imported, you can further edit the topography by using SketchUp’s modeling tools. Add textures, vegetation, or any other elements to enhance your model’s realism.
